Which comment by the nurse would best support relationship building with a victim of partner abuse?
 
  a. You are feeling violated, because you thought you could trust your partner.
  b. I'm here for you. I want you to tell me about the bad things that happened to you.
  c. I was very worried about you. I knew you were living in a potentially violent situation.
  d. Abusers often target people who are passive. I will refer you to an assertiveness class.

Answer to Question 1

A
The correct option uses the therapeutic technique of reflection. It shows empathy, an important nursing attribute for establishing rapport and building a relationship. None of the other options would help the patient feel accepted.

Answer to Question 2

D
In the recoil stage, emotional stress is high as the individual strives to come to terms with what has happened. The victim talks about the incident and his or her feelings about the trauma. Reorganization is the third stage of recovery, in which grief over the incident is resolved. Retribution is not a stage in the recovery process. In the impact stage, common responses are shock, denial, and disbelief. Disorganization may be a reaction in the impact stage.
